THE GORGEOUS HUSSY (1936)

Everyone in-front & behind the camera/above & below the line is at their worst in this inert period historical, stiffer than the Petticoat that gave name to this Andrew Jackson political scandal.*  Joan Crawford, never at ease in period pieces (or in flouncy clothes), is Peggy O’Neal Eaton, serial inamorata to Virginia Senator Melvyn Douglas, Navy hunk Robert Taylor, Man-about-town James Stewart, Cabinet Secretary Franchot Tone; as well as enjoying the personal protection of President Lionel Barrymore . . . er, Andrew Jackson.  More sinned against than sinning (in this telling), her choice of romantic chaperones always blowing up in her face.  In some ways, it’s Crawford’s PARNELL/’37, the Clark Gable mega-flop historical.  Only this one somehow made money.  All those stars*; and just as many in support.  A pity, too, as whenever we leave the romance and head to the Capital, you can faintly make out the proto-Civil War story wasted here.
